About

Daniel Fraiman has authored 33 papers that have received a total of 1.5k indexed citations. This includes 19 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ience, 7 papers in Statistical and Nonlinear Physics and 6 papers in Molecular Biology. The topics of these papers are Functional Brain Connectivity Studies (14 papers), Neural dynamics and brain function (14 papers) and Complex Network Analysis Techniques (4 papers). Daniel Fraiman is often cited by papers focused on Functional Brain Connectivity Studies (14 papers), Neural dynamics and brain function (14 papers) and Complex Network Analysis Techniques (4 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Argentina, United States and Brazil. Daniel Fraiman's co-authors include Dante R. Chialvo, Pablo Balenzuela, Silvina Ponce Dawson, Agustín Ibáñez and Lucas Sedeño and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, NeuroImage and Stroke
